The US Dollar is not seeing gains despite improved risk sentiment in the market.
From Investing.com: 2025-05-05 06:37:00
Key Asian markets are closed for bank holidays, leading to a quiet start to the week. Investors are keeping an eye on the S&P 500 after nine consecutive positive sessions, with the index still below recent highs. The Fed meeting on Wednesday will focus on tariff talks, as Trump’s recent comments indicate a possible lowering of tariffs on Chinese imports. In Australia, the Labour Party’s election win has boosted the Aussie currency. Gold remains stable, while oil prices retreat due to OPEC+ reports of increasing production.
